When can wintersweet be sown?

Can the seeds be planted?

First of all, we need to know whether wintersweet flowers can be sown. Of course it can be sown, but it should be noted that the wintersweet flowers grown from the seeds are not hereditary, and sowing and propagation requires a long time and energy, so it is best to choose asexual propagation methods such as grafting and cuttings when propagating.

When to sow

The time for sowing wintersweet flowers actually mainly exists in two seasons, which are spring and autumn. Both seasons are good times for sowing.

When sowing wintersweet flowers in spring, it is usually done in February to March, and the seedlings will emerge in April. When sowing in spring, germination is required so that the seeds can germinate normally. Soak the wintersweet seeds in warm water. It usually takes 24 hours to germinate and then sow them in sandy soil. They will usually sprout in 15-20 days.

The time to sow wintersweet flowers in autumn is usually in July or August. After the fruits of the wintersweet are ripe, the seeds are harvested for sowing. After harvesting the ripe fruits of the wintersweet, take out the seeds, dry them and you can sow them at any time. Because the seeds are newly harvested, they are relatively fresh and more active, so they can be sown at any time. Generally, seedlings will emerge more than 10 days after sowing. The survival rate is relatively high if wintersweet flowers are sown in autumn.
